The average of 3, 15, and my number is 40. What is my number?

Answer:

102

Step-by-step explanation:

Let your number be n

The average of 3 ,15 and your number is found by adding the three numbers and dividing by 3

(3+15+n)/3

That is equal to 40

(3+15+n)/3=40

Multiply each side by 3 to get rid of the fraction

(3+15+n)/3 *3 = 40*3

(3+15+n) = 120

Combine like terms

18+n = 120

Subtract 18 from each side

18-18 +n = 120-18

n =102

Your number is 102
